From June 7th-11th, UCFB and GIS will be hosting the Virtual Toronto Global Sports Summit and giving students, alumni and staff the chance to hear from some of the leading names in Canadian sport.

From ice hockey to soccer to basketball, Toronto is home to North American sporting instititions such as NBA’s Raptors, MLS’ Toronto FC and NHL’s Maple Leafs. Keep on reading to find out who’ll be talking and what to expect from day one of the summit...

Introduction to Maple Leafs Sports & Entertainment (MLSE)

Chris Shewfelt - Vice President, Business Operations, Toronto FC and Toronto Argos

Currently in his 19th season at MLSE, Chris has worked in virtually all disciplines within the sales and marketing groups, including leadership responsibilities across partnerships, ticketing, marketing, community sport partnerships and service. In February 2018, Chris was promoted to the position of Vice President, Business Operations with Toronto FC and the Toronto Argos. Previously, Chris served as Head of Business Operations, Toronto FC, and Global Partnerships, MLSE; Senior Director of Global Partnerships, MLSE and Director Corporate Partnerships; and Community Sport Partnerships, Toronto FC.

Chris, 40, is a two-time winner of the MLS Partnerships Executive of the Year (2008 and 2017) and was honoured in 2015 by the Canada Sport Business Awards as one of the “five to watch”. Chris is also a five-time National Champion in Men’s Softball and has represented Canada in international competition.

Food & Beverage Management and Bringing Toronto to its Feet

Dan Morrow - Senior Vice President, Food & Beverage, MLSE

Dan Morrow is Senior Vice President of Food and Beverage at Maple Leaf Sports & Entertainment (MLSE) where he oversees an F&B operation that encompasses Scotiabank Arena, BMO Field, Coca Cola Coliseum, Real Sports Bar & Grill and e11even. He joined the organization in February 2014 as Senior Director of Food and Beverage.

Dan has spent his career in the sports and entertainment industry. Having spent thirteen years at Rogers Centre in various roles working for Levy Restaurants, ultimately leading the location as Director of Operations. A career highlight saw Dan move to Vancouver in 2007 to lead the F&B Operations for the Vancouver 2010 Olympics. Dan lead the development of the food and beverage planning for the 2010 Olympics building strong relationships with key governmental stakeholders, vendors and other organizations that ultimately lead to a successful Olympic Games.

Dan is an active member of the food and beverage community and is currently past Chair of the Board of the Ontario Restaurant, Hotel, Motel Association (ORHMA). An organization dedicated to enhancing the business climate of the hospitality industry. Dan is a Certified Professional Accountant (CPA-CMA) and is a graduate of the University of Western Ontario.

Matthew Sullivan, Corporate Executive Chef, Food & Beverage

Corporate Executive Chef, Matthew Sullivan oversees all MLSE properties and restaurants. He started his culinary career attending and graduating from Stratford Chefs School. Since then, he has obtained a tremendous number of accolades over the years. He has staged in restaurants all over the world–across Asia, Europe and North America, including Michelin Star kitchens. With these experiences, his passion for cooking and love for food grew even stronger. This allowed him to eventually become a Chopped Canada champion and a competitor on season 6 of Top Chef Canada with an impressive showing, being a front-runner of the show.

Chef Sullivan’s career at MLSE started over four years ago, where he was instrumental in pushing the food program at Real Sports and the Arena’s quick service locations forward at an exponential level. Now in his role as Corporate Executive Chef, Chef Sullivan supports the Culinary Director, Chris Zielinski and their team of talented chefs to continuously grow MLSE’s food program
